A measure to change the state’s payday-lending system before new federal government regulations kick in easily cleared a House panel Tuesday. The bill (HB 857) was approved by the Government Operations and Technology Appropriations Subcommittee. On Thursday, Florida faith leaders pushed forth a single message: payday lending expansion bills currently under consideration in Tallahassee (HB 857 and SB 920) are usury and should be stopped.
